Q. Explain about Folded network?
Folded network: When all the outlets/inlets are connected to the subscriber lines, logical connection appears as displayed in figure. In this case, output lines are folded back to input and hence the network is known as a folded network. Four types of connection can be established:
1. Local call connection between two subscribers in the system.
2. Outgoing call connection between a subscriber and an outgoing trunk.
3. Incoming call connection between an incoming trunk and a local subscriber.
4. Transit calls connection between an incoming trunk and an outgoing trunk.
In a folded network with N subscriber, there may be a maximum of N/2 simultaneous calls or information interchanges.
